This station is designed to cater to travelers' diverse needs. Ticket buying is a breeze with a ticket office available Monday to Saturday from 06:10 to 19:30, slightly varying on Sundays. Self-service ticket machines streamline your journey, and the station supports smartcard issuance and validation. Accessibility is paramount here, with step-free access in parts of the station, an induction loop, and ramps available for train access. While the station doesn't include a waiting room, there are seating areas and accessible toilets available.
While there's no luggage storage or waiting lounge, a coffee shop ensures you're fueled for your journey, alongside a newspaper shop for a light read. Keep in mind that while CCTV is in operation for safety, public wifi and an ATM aren't available at this station. Cyclists will find sheltered spaces by the ticket office, encouraged to leave bikes here at their own risk due to the absence of CCTV coverage in this area.
Interconnectivity with other forms of transport is seamless, thanks to multiple bus connections. For instance, travelers heading towards Lewisham can catch their bus at the Kidbrooke Park Road Bus Stop L, pinpointed by the innovative what3words address: "media.spoke.spice". Meanwhile, those traveling towards Dartford should look out for Bus Stop M, known as "tunnel.hulk.jumpy". Access more information on travel connections and routes in a convenient printable format.

Enfield Town station strives to make the journey of every passenger as smooth and enjoyable as possible. Equipped with a ticket office that operates from early morning to late evening during the weekdays, and slightly reduced hours over the weekend, passengers can purchase and collect tickets with ease. For those who have pre-purchased tickets online, collection is available from on-site ticket machines, which are fully accessible.
While luggage storage facilities are unavailable, passengers can enjoy peace of mind with CCTV security and customer help points accessible for queries. The station accommodates various needs with step-free access across its platforms, accessible toilets, and induction loops for those with hearing impairments. Cyclists can take advantage of the 15 Sheffield Stand spaces provided on Platform 3, supported by CCTV for additional security.
Once you've arrived at Enfield Town station, numerous onward travel options are at your disposal. For local commutes, Transport for London (TfL) buses conveniently operate from outside the station. Should rail services be interrupted, a replacement bus service is available at Bus Stop K on Southbury Road heading towards Liverpool Street. Additionally, a minicab firm is located right within the station buildings, making it simple to continue your journey by car. For an eco-friendly and healthy option, bicycle hire is an option, with Bike & Go available for those keen on cycling around the area.
